Edo Court Orders Remand of Suspect in Kidnapping and Armed Robbery Case
Edo Court Orders Remand of Suspect in Kidnapping and Armed Robbery Case — The Abuja Times Newsroom

A suspect has been ordered to remain in custody by a court in Edo State after being charged with kidnapping and armed robbery. The police prosecutor revealed that the suspect, whose identity has not been disclosed, along with another individual who is currently at large, allegedly perpetrated the crimes on July 6, 2023, at Igue Farm Road, near Igarra, within the Auchi Division.

During the court proceedings, the prosecutor detailed the circumstances surrounding the alleged offenses, indicating that the actions of the suspects have raised significant concerns regarding security in the region. The court has set a date for further hearings, allowing the prosecution to gather additional evidence while ensuring that the suspect remains in custody to prevent any potential flight risk.

Community members have expressed their apprehension regarding the rise in violent crimes, including kidnapping and robbery, which have become increasingly prevalent in certain areas of Edo State. Local authorities are under pressure to enhance security measures and address the root causes of such criminal activities to restore public confidence.

“The court’s decision to remand the suspect is a crucial step towards ensuring justice is served and deterring future crimes in the community,” a community leader stated.

As the legal proceedings unfold, both law enforcement officials and citizens are hopeful that this case will serve as a warning to potential offenders and contribute to the broader efforts aimed at curbing the tide of crime in Edo State.
